Memorial shrine for Nichidatsu Fujii, Japanese Buddhist monk and founder of Nipponzan-Myohoji order, Shanti Stupa, Pokhara
   
   
   
   
   
   
   
Peace Pagodas have been constructed around the world since World War II to inspire peace for people of all races and creeds, many of which were built under the guidance of Nichidatsu Fujii, a Japanese Buddhist monk and founder of the Nipponzan-Myohoji Buddhist Order. Shanti Stupa in Pokhara is a popular tourist attraction and provides a panoramic view of the Annapurna range and Pokhara city.
